'''''Wundersmith: The Calling of Morrigan Crow''''' is a 2018 novel written by Jessica Townsend. It is the second book in the ''[[Nevermoor]]'' series. The second entry is more character driven than the first, dealing with themes of betrayal and acceptance.
 
Just because Morrigan has made it into the Wunderous Society does not mean her troubles are over. Possessing an elusive anda dangerous ability, she is feared by the fellow members at her Unit 919. Other than Cadance Blackburn and Hawthrone Swift, she has no other friends in Unitthe 919unit, and theyother members are quick to turn the other way when she asks for help. She went in expecting a group of brothers and sisters bonded for life, a group of people she could depend on, but found none of that. As if her situation couldn't get worse, her unit is blackmailed, and forced to protect her secret. Things went from bad to worse when people and Wunimals from all over Nevermoor start disappearing, with invesigations turning up nothing.
 
It is up to Morrigan in true [[Plucky Girl]] fashion to solve the mystery of the disappearing animals, with the help of her [[The Power of Friendship|closes friends]]. Her abilities will be put to the test, and her relationships with both her friends and mentor Jupiter North stretched to its limits, all in the second book in the ''[[Nevermoor]]'' series and the direct sequel to ''[[Nevermoor: The Trials of Morrigan Crow]]''.
